Whirlwind Golf Club features 36 holes across 242 acres. Wild horses and native beasts roam the landscape - so don't let them drag you away. While just 12 miles from the metropolis of Phoenix, Whirlwind Golf Club's Cattail Course takes golfers to a secluded and scenic environment, where desert tranquility and beauty is a silent playing partner throughout.

Gary Panks designed the courses at Whirlwind Golf Club. The par-72 Cattail measures 7,222 yards and beings on Arrow Shot, a par-4 413 yarder; the South Mountain Range's canyons will guide you, but shoot straight. Things get long on Two Mesquites, the second hole, a par-5 517 yarder, which does feature Mesquites, a staple for the Gila River Indian Community, used in construction, medicine and food.

Finish up on Last Hole, a par-4 450 yarder that offers a good test to close on, as it is the course's most demanding to drive.

Don't golf here St. Patricks Day

Other then the massive St. Patties day concert nearby at Rawhide, which was super loud and annoying, the course is great. That is my first time hearing noise at this course as I usually play it because its a NO HOUSE desert course which is usually peaceful. I play here a lot and this was my first bad experience, but not the courses fault. Also at the clubhouse where they don't allow E-cigs on the patio. Seriously? I vape apples and strawberries who is going to complain about that? I won't be hanging out in the club house drinking and eating after golf now since their policy on e-cigs has changed. Also the last 2 times I ate at the club house the food was just average. But the staff is 5 star. The course and staff at Whirlwind are great though. I've played Cattail so many times and last week I finally got to play DevilsClaw. And wow, what a difference. Cattail is so much harder. Far more challenging shots and hard bunker placements and water on Cattail. Overall Whirlwind is one of my favorite courses and the indian reservation does not have summer water restrictions so the greens are always perfect, even in the summer! Always coyotes on the course and even rattlesnakes, some wildlife entertainment. The practice facilities here are 5 star as well. Whirlwind is the nicest course in Chandler that I'm aware of.

Fun and Challenging

Cattail is a fun and challenging course. Fairways are generous but you still need to hit some targets or your approach shots will be difficult to get close. Greens are well protected with bunkers and undulations. There are some forced carries but should not be too difficult from the right set of tees. Nice views of South Mountain, great practice facility.
